Direct Answer
According to various sources, Assassin’s Creed Odyssey has a larger map than Assassin’s Creed Valhalla. The map in Odyssey spans approximately 90.7 square miles, while Valhalla’s map is around 60.7 square miles. This means that Odyssey’s map is roughly 50% larger than Valhalla’s.
Comparison of Maps
Here is a comparison of the maps in both games:
| Game | Map Size (square miles) |
|---|---|
| Assassin’s Creed Odyssey | 90.7 |
| Assassin’s Creed Valhalla | 60.7 |
